Blood, cardio vascular, Respiratory, skeletal and your digestive system are all essential counterparts to the muscular system without these other systems the muscular system would not be able to function, its important to remember that the muscular system need oxygen, nutrients, hormones, gases and proteins and calcium to function and build.

How many bones make the Muscular System work?

The Muscular System is made up of over 600 muscles that work with the skeletal system, which is composed of 206 bones. These bones provide attachment points for muscles, allowing movement and supporting the functions of the muscular system.

What is made up of the muscles that let you move?

The muscular system is made up of the muscles that enable movement. It consists of more than 600 muscles, including skeletal muscles, smooth muscles, and cardiac muscles. These muscles work together to allow voluntary and involuntary movements in the body.
